Wicked Knee is a rolling slurry of a band concocted of:
–Billy Martin (percussion)
–Steven Bernstein (trumpet)
–Curtis Fowlkes (trombone)
–Marcus Rojas (tuba)
New Orleans is barely more New Orleans than the tunes these guys are playing. There’s an impending EP, but in the meantime, you can listen to some tracks on MySpace, and check out the videos below on YouTube.
The first video is from Billy Martin’s “Anti-Instructional” DVD, now available, called Life on Drums which features Wicked Knee.
